A ‘free’ office manager helped her husband steal over $2 million from a British law firm that funded the couple’s lavish lifestyle, reports the BBC News.

A Leeds Crown Court jury found Simon Morgan, 50, guilty of six theft counts. His wife, Ann, 55, wasn’t fit to stand trial for her role in allegedly helping him take money from the Milners law firm to fund a lavish lifestyle and pay for luxuries including a deposit on a Ferrari.

The Daily Mail provides additional details about the credit card bills, designer clothes, hotel rooms, restaurant meals and vacations that the couple reportedly covered with the help of law firm funds.

At one point, the newspaper says, the family took a trip to Antigua that cost some $30,000.
